Dig a little deeper! Ant kits are powerful hands-on learning tools that bring science to life, allowing students to observe real insect behavior while exploring biology, ecology, and complex systems through direct, engaging experience.
Ant kits offer many educational benefits. They help children develop Scientific Observation Skills, encourage curiosity about nature, learn life cycles and biology, understand ecosystems, and more!
Using an ant hill kit as an educational tool offers a hands-on way to learn about biology, ecology, and teamwork. It allows students to observe ants’ behaviors, such as cooperation, communication, and problem-solving, in real time. This direct interaction helps deepen understanding and curiosity beyond textbooks.
For example, students might learn how ants work together to build tunnels and gather food, highlighting the importance of collaboration. In daily life, this lesson can translate into improved teamwork skills, encouraging children to cooperate with friends or classmates when solving problems or completing group activities. Observing an ant hill also teaches patience and responsibility, as students must care for the ants and maintain their environment, skills that are valuable in many real-world situations.
Ant hill kits turn biology from a distant concept into a living, breathing system students can observe in real time. Learners witness anatomy, life cycles, communication, and ecosystem roles unfolding beneath the soil, making abstract ideas like adaptation and interdependence easier to understand. Watching ants tunnel, care for brood, and respond to environmental changes builds a deeper grasp of how organisms survive and function together.
For example, a student who observes how ants adjust their behavior based on food availability or obstacles may apply that lesson to daily life by becoming more adaptable—planning ahead, conserving resources, or adjusting strategies when faced with challenges at school or home.
An ant hill kit provides a unique and engaging way to understand ant ecosystems and social behavior. By observing ants in a controlled environment, students can learn about the structure of ant colonies, roles such as workers and queens, and how ants interact to maintain their community. This hands-on experience makes complex biological concepts more accessible and memorable.
For example, students may notice how ants communicate through pheromones to organize tasks efficiently. This observation can inspire lessons about effective communication and cooperation in human settings. Understanding ant ecosystems through the ant hill also fosters a greater respect for nature, encouraging more responsible environmental behaviors.
Ant Hill kits spark curiosity by turning the classroom into a tiny, hidden, underground world of discovery. Students naturally begin asking questions as they observe ants carving tunnels, communicating, and solving problems in real time. This hands-on exposure encourages inquiry, prediction, and exploration, helping learners develop a habit of wondering “why” and “how” instead of passively receiving information. Over time, curiosity becomes self-fueling, as each observation leads to new questions. For example, a student intrigued by how ants find food may start paying closer attention to patterns in everyday life—like noticing how people navigate crowded spaces or how systems at home and school function. This is how curious minds grow!
By observing the daily activities of your busy ants, your children will gain a greater sense of compassion and responsibility for the living things around us - no matter how small! Ant Hill kits turn responsibility into something you can see crawling, digging, and depending on you. Students must monitor moisture, provide food, and maintain a stable environment, learning that small, consistent actions keep a living system healthy. This daily care builds accountability and patience, as neglect quickly shows consequences within the colony.

Ant Hill kits bring insects, ecosystems, and life cycles into motion. Students observe ant anatomy and behavior, track colony growth, and see ecosystem roles like resource use and waste management. For example, while studying life cycles, they can connect brood development stages to broader biological patterns, transforming static lessons into living systems. The possibilities are endless!
Ant hill kits quietly recruit the whole classroom, extending beyond science into math, language arts, and art. Students measure tunnel growth, track population changes, and graph activity patterns in math. In language arts, they write observations or creative stories from an ant’s perspective. In art, they sketch colony structures or design habitats, blending data with imagination into a multidisciplinary learning experience.
An ant colony becomes a shared stage where students gather, compare observations, and piece together patterns like tiny detectives. As they discuss tunnel changes or ant behaviors, they practice listening, questioning, and building on each other’s ideas. Group roles and collective note-taking mirror the colony itself, reinforcing teamwork, communication, and the understanding that discovery often works best as a team effort.
Teachers can turn the classroom into a living colony by assigning roles like “foragers,” “nurses,” “builders,” and “defenders,” each mirroring real ant responsibilities. Students take ownership of specific tasks, creating a system where success depends on cooperation and communication. For example, “builders” might organize materials while “foragers” gather resources, all coordinated through shared goals—just like ants using signals from glands such as the Dufour’s or mandibular glands to stay aligned!

Ant pheromones guide everything from foraging trails to alarm signals, allowing thousands of individuals to act as one coordinated superorganism. These chemical messages are precise, adaptable, and essential for survival. By decoding how ants communicate through pheromones, scientists are able to find remarkable insights into collective behavior, ecology, and even innovative solutions for human technology and complex systems.
